Coconut Oil Benefits: Natural Wellness Tips For Healthier Skin And Hair

Coconut oil is a versatile natural ingredient used for cooking, skincare, and haircare for generations. Rich in medium-chain triglycerides (MCTs) and lauric acid, it offers antimicrobial, moisturizing, and metabolic benefits. This article explores seven practical advantages of using pure coconut oil safely — from improving skin hydration and hair strength to supporting digestion and immunity — and gives simple, everyday ways to include it in your routine.



✨ DEEP SKIN MOISTURISER

Coconut oil is an excellent natural moisturizer that helps trap moisture in the outer layer of skin. Its fatty acids replenish the skin barrier and reduce dryness, flakiness, and tightness after bathing. Use a small amount on damp skin to lock in hydration — especially on elbows, knees, and heels. For sensitive skin, patch-test first and prefer refined or fractionated oils if you react to raw coconut scent.

💁 HAIR NOURISHMENT BOOST

Coconut oil penetrates hair shafts better than many other oils, helping reduce protein loss and prevent breakage. Regular pre-wash or overnight oiling improves shine, reduces split ends, and soothes dry scalps. For best results, warm the oil slightly, massage into the scalp and lengths, leave 30 minutes or overnight, then shampoo gently. Use sparingly on fine hair to avoid greasiness.

🥥 DIGESTIVE SUPPORT & ENERGY

Medium-chain triglycerides (MCTs) in coconut oil are quickly absorbed and converted into energy, offering a fast fuel source without large insulin spikes for most people. When used moderately in cooking or as part of breakfast, MCTs may support metabolism and sustained energy. People with digestive issues should introduce coconut oil slowly and monitor tolerance. Always consult a healthcare professional if you have metabolic or GI concerns.

💆 SCALP & SKIN THERAPY

Topical coconut oil soothes dry, flaky skin and can reduce mild dandruff when used as a scalp massage oil. Its emollient action smooths rough patches and can calm irritation. For acne-prone or oily skin, use cautiously—some people find coconut oil comedogenic (can block pores). Try a small area first, and prefer fractionated or lighter carrier oils if pore-clogging is a concern.


✅ SAFE USE & PRACTICAL TIPS

Use high-quality, virgin cold-pressed coconut oil for skincare and haircare; choose food-grade if consuming. Start with small amounts — a teaspoon in cooking, a pea-sized drop for face moisturizing, or a light scalp massage once or twice weekly. Avoid overheating the oil, and store it in a cool, dark place. If you have allergies or skin reactions, stop use and seek medical advice.
